How Uber Eats Works

Getting started as an Uber Eats driver is straightforward. First, sign up through the mobile app or the official website, providing necessary documents such as your driver’s license and vehicle registration. Once approved, you will gain access to the app’s dashboard, where you’ll manage delivery requests. You’ll select jobs that fit your schedule and navigate the app’s built-in GPS to ensure timely deliveries.

Earnings Potential with Uber Eats

The financial aspects of driving for Uber Eats are enticing, with earnings largely depending on your location and effort. On average, Uber Eats drivers earn around $18 per hour, influenced by peak times and tips. Tips can remarkably boost your income—often comprising nearly half of a driver’s earnings.

Factors Affecting Earnings

Several factors can affect your earnings with Uber Eats. These include the area you operate in, with urban locations typically offering more opportunities. Additionally, seasonality, promotions, and the ability to efficiently navigate traffic also play significant roles in how much you can earn.

Pros and Cons of Delivering for Uber Eats

To make an informed decision about Uber Eats as a car side hustle, it’s essential to weigh its pros and cons.

The primary benefits include its unmatched flexibility, ease of entry, and the potential to earn steadily. Unlike traditional jobs, you do not need formal education or specialized skills to start—just a car, a smartphone, and a reliable internet connection.

While there are clear upsides, some challenges exist. Vehicle maintenance and fuel costs can eat into profits. Additionally, local competition may mean fluctuating demand, leading to sporadic earnings.

Optimizing Delivery Routes

Utilizing traffic applications like Waze or Google Maps can help identify the fastest routes, saving both time and money. Familiarizing yourself with local traffic patterns is also a savvy strategy to ensure you’re delivering promptly.

Customer Interaction and Tips

Building rapport with customers is not just courteous but profitable. By providing timely updates and professional service, drivers often see better tips. Remember, a smile and a little professionalism can turn a one-time customer into a regular.
